Abstract

The invention discloses an auxiliary thread clamping mechanism of a sewing machine, which comprises an installation structure, an auxiliary thread clamping structure and a thread roller structure; the mounting structure comprises: the mounting plate comprises a mounting plate, wherein a first fixing structure is arranged on the mounting plate, a U-shaped chute is fixedly arranged on the bottom side of the mounting plate, a sliding plate is connected inside the U-shaped chute in a sliding manner, a supporting plate is fixedly arranged on the bottom side of the sliding plate, and a limiting structure is arranged on the bottom side of the mounting plate on the left side of the sliding plate; auxiliary wire clamping structure: the thread clamping mechanism is simple in structure, can adjust the clamping force of the thread clamping device, is convenient to use, can be rapidly installed to the thread clamping device, and is convenient to detach and maintain.

Auxiliary thread clamping mechanism of sewing machine
Technical Field
The invention relates to the technical field of auxiliary thread clamping of sewing machines, in particular to an auxiliary thread clamping mechanism of a sewing machine.
Background
The sewing machine is a machine which uses one or more sewing threads to form one or more stitches on a sewing material to enable one or more layers of sewing materials to be interwoven or sewn, the sewing machine can sew fabrics such as cotton, hemp, silk, wool, artificial fiber and the like, and products such as leather, plastics, paper and the like, the sewn stitches are neat, beautiful, flat and firm, the sewing speed is high, the use is simple and convenient, and artistic forms such as hand-push embroidery computer embroidery and the like are derived.
Disclosure of Invention
The invention aims to overcome the existing defects and provides an auxiliary thread clamping mechanism of a sewing machine, which has a simple structure, can adjust the clamping force of a thread clamping device so as to be convenient to use, can quickly install the thread clamping device, is convenient to disassemble and maintain, and can effectively solve the problems in the background art.
In order to achieve the purpose, the invention provides the following technical scheme: the auxiliary thread clamping mechanism of the sewing machine comprises a mounting structure, an auxiliary thread clamping structure and a thread roller structure;
the mounting structure comprises: the mounting plate comprises a mounting plate, wherein a first fixing structure is arranged on the mounting plate, a U-shaped chute is fixedly arranged on the bottom side of the mounting plate, a sliding plate is connected inside the U-shaped chute in a sliding manner, a supporting plate is fixedly arranged on the bottom side of the sliding plate, and a limiting structure is arranged on the bottom side of the mounting plate on the left side of the sliding plate;
auxiliary wire clamping structure: the cable clamp comprises a first mounting column, wherein a retaining ring is fixedly arranged on the side surface of the first mounting column, a cable limiting structure is arranged on the side surface of the retaining ring, a cable clamping block is connected to the side surface of the first mounting column through a bearing and is positioned on the outer side of the retaining ring, a pressing ring, a first spring and a sleeve pressing barrel are sequentially arranged on the side surface of the first mounting column from inside to outside, the sleeve pressing barrel is connected to the side surface of the first mounting column through threads, the pressing ring is pressed on the side surface of the cable clamping block through an anti-friction mechanism, and a rotating structure is arranged on the outer side of the sleeve pressing barrel;
the wire rod structure: the wire drawing mechanism comprises a second mounting column, wherein a fixing ring is fixedly arranged on the side surface of the second mounting column, a wire rod is sleeved on the side surface of the second mounting column and positioned outside the fixing ring, a protective shell is sleeved on the outer side of the wire rod, the protective shell is connected with the fixing ring through a second fixing structure, and a wire drawing mechanism is arranged on the side surface of the protective shell;
the first mounting column and the second mounting column are in threaded connection with the side face of the supporting plate, the third fixing structures are arranged on the side faces of the first mounting column and the second mounting column, and the wire clamping block is located on the right of the wire rod.

Referring to fig. 1-4, the present invention provides a technical solution: the auxiliary thread clamping mechanism of the sewing machine comprises a mounting structure 5, an auxiliary thread clamping structure 2 and a thread roller structure 3; mounting structure 5: the auxiliary thread clamping mechanism comprises a mounting plate 51, wherein a first fixing structure 4 is arranged on the mounting plate 51, a U-shaped chute 52 is fixedly arranged on the bottom side of the mounting plate 51, a sliding plate 53 is slidably connected inside the U-shaped chute 52, a supporting plate 54 is fixedly arranged on the bottom side of the sliding plate 53, a limiting structure 6 is arranged on the bottom side of the mounting plate 51 at the left side of the sliding plate 53, the mounting plate 51 is mounted on a sewing machine through the first fixing structure 4, the sliding plate 53 and the supporting plate 54 are slidably connected inside the U-shaped chute 52 on the mounting plate 51, and therefore the auxiliary thread clamping mechanism can be rapidly mounted, can be detached and maintained, and is convenient for a user to use; When in use: the mounting plate 51 is mounted on the sewing machine through the first fixing structure 4, the sliding plate 53 and the supporting plate 54 are connected inside the U-shaped sliding groove 52 on the mounting plate 51 in a sliding manner, so that the auxiliary thread clamping mechanism can be mounted quickly and can be detached and maintained, and the use of a user is convenient, the rotating structure 11 drives the sleeve pressing barrel 26 to rotate, the sleeve pressing barrel 26 extrudes the first spring 25, the elastic force of the first spring 25 pushes the pressing ring 24 to move along the first mounting column 21, the pressing ring 24 presses the thread clamping block 23 through the anti-friction mechanism 10, the clamping force of the thread clamping device can be adjusted, so that the use is convenient, the blocking ring 22 can limit the thread clamping block 23, the fixing ring 32 on the second mounting column 31 can block the thread roller 33 sleeved on the second mounting column 31, the thread roller 33 can be limited, and the fixing structure 34 can be mounted on the fixing ring 32 through the second fixing structure 8, further, the protective shell 34 protects the wire rod 33, and the wire rod 33 can be conveniently installed.
